1FEATURES OF YOUR HYUNDAI 80 B350B01CM-AAT Auto Wiper Operation (If Installed) If the ignition switch is turned "ON" when the wiper switch is set in "AUTO" mode, or the wiper switch is set in "AUTO" mode when the ignition switch is "ON", or the speed control knob is turned toward the "F" position when the wiper switch is in "AUTO" mode, the wiper will operate once to perform a self-check of the system. Set the wiper to the "OFF" position when the wiper is not in use. ! WARNING: When the ignition switch is on and the windshield wiper switch is placed in the "AUTO" mode, please use caution to avoid any hand injury: The wiper system may automatically activate. The fingers or hand might be caught in the wiper. o Do not touch the upper end of the windshield glass facing the rain sensor. o Do not wipe the upper end of the windshield glass with a cloth. o Do not put pressure on the windshield glass. NOTE: If there is heavy accumulation of snow or ice on the windshield glass, there will be a 10 minute waiting period prior to the operation of the automatic windshield wipers system. OCM027071A When the windshield wiper switch is placed in the "AUTO" position, the rain sensor located on the upper end of windshield glass senses the amount of rainfall and controls for the appropriate length of the intervals between wipes appropriately.
